Abstract

Learning and teaching of sorting algorithms are very challenging for students and teachers as well. The issues are more highlighted in the online form of teaching which was the only form of schooling from March to June of the school year 2019/2020 in Croatia due to the COVID-19 pandemic. The use of visualization tools could be used for lowering the abstraction of complex programming concepts such as sorting algorithms. We conducted research among two high-school classes (n=52) in one science and mathematics high school while teaching sorting algorithms during online schooling. In the experimental group, we used visualization tools VisuAlgo and Python Tutor for teaching sorting algorithms and their implementation in Python as well. We examined students’ attitudes towards programming and online teaching as well. We present the results of the research in this paper.
